Why Galmpton is a great choice for family vacations
Galmpton offers a mix of rural charm and coastal access. The village is part of Torbay, known as the English Riviera, which means you’re never far from a sandy beach, a family-friendly promenade, or a scenic coastal path. For families who value convenience, you’ll find grocery stores, cafes, and essential services within a short drive, while the surrounding towns—Brixham, Paignton, and Torquay—expand your dining and entertainment options. The area is well-suited to day trips that’re easy on small legs and big opinions, with gentle walks, wildlife experiences, and engaging cultural sites nearby. Top family-friendly activities in and around Galmpton
Family adventures near Galmpton balance outdoor excitement with opportunities for rest and discovery. Here are some reliable, kid-pleasing options to consider when planning your stay:
- Beach days at nearby Goodrington Sands, Paignton, or Broadsands, with gentle slopes and safe paddling zones for younger children
- Coastal walks along short sections of the South West Coast Path, with scenic viewpoints and plenty of benches for snack breaks
- Visits to Greenway Estate (the National Trust home of Agatha Christie) just a short drive away, offering grounds to explore, kid-friendly trails, and engaging family programs
- Boat and ferry excursions from Brixham or Torquay harbors, giving families a chance to spot sea life and enjoy views from the water
- Wildlife encounters at nearby nature reserves and nature trails, ideal for curious kids who want to learn about birds, boats, and coast wildlife
- Mini-adventures in Paignton Zoo or Babbacombe Model Village for a playful, low-stress day out
Each activity can be tailored to your family’s energy level. If you have toddlers, plan more frequent rest breaks and shade breaks on bright days. For older kids, a wildlife scavenger hunt or a simple nature photography challenge can add an extra layer of excitement to ordinary strolls.

Beaches, safety, and practical tips for families
Safety is a cornerstone of family travel in Galmpton. When you’re booking a vacation rental or a Yurt, confirm safety features and practical conveniences. Look for:
- Enclosed or walled gardens, high fences, and gate safety to prevent wandering younger children
- Smoke alarms, carbon monoxide detectors, and a clear fire evacuation plan posted in the home
- Well-lit entryways, secure parking, and a simple layout that minimizes the risk of trips and falls
- Streamlined access to medical services and a small first aid kit included in the property
- Limited stairs or safe stair arrangements for toddlers, plus portable high chairs and travel cots if provided
When you’re out and about, bring essentials for comfort and safety: water, hats, sun protection, a light jacket for coastal breezes, and a compact backpack with snacks and a small first aid kit. If you’re exploring with a stroller, check terrain and gate access for any uneven paths or steps along the route.
